Kindle and FireOS push object
The
kindle_push
object allows you to modify or create Kindle and FireOS push notifications via our messaging endpoints.

{
"alert": (required, string) the notification message,
"title": (required, string) the title that appears in the notification drawer,
"extra": (optional, object) additional keys and values to be sent in the push,
"message_variation_id": (optional, string) used when providing a campaign_id to specify which message variation this message should be tracked under (must be an Kindle/FireOS Push Message),
"priority": (optional, integer) the notification priority value,
"collapse_key": (optional, string) the collapse key for this message,
// Specifying "default" in the sound field will play the standard notification sound
"sound": (optional, string) the location of a custom notification sound within the app,
"custom_uri": (optional, string) a web URL, or Deep Link URI
}
The priority
parameter will accept values from -2
to 2
, where -2
represents the lowest priority and 2
represents highest priority. 0
is the default value. Any values sent that outside of that integer range will default to 0
.
